Interests
The ultimate goal of nuclear astrophysics is to understand how nuclear processes generate the energy of stars over their lifetimes and, in doing so, synthesize heavier elements from the primordial hydrogen and helium produced in the Big Bang. A close interplay among stellar modeling, nuclear physics, and astronomical observation is essential in order to achieve the best understanding. In my research, I utilize the available facilities and experimental technologies, combined with the latest nuclear theory, to determine those nuclear reaction data with strong astrophysical significance. I am also interested in developing new experimental techniques and equipments for the proposed U.S. radioactive beam facility. The experiments are carried out with the local accelerators at Notre Dame as well as the national user facilities such as ATLAS accelerator at Argonne National Laboratory.
